The Bangalore Chamber of Industry and Commerce (BCIC) this year completes 42 years of its journey, marking a long association with State of Karnataka. Driven by its Members, BCIC has emerged as a strong and proactive institution working towards the growth, competitiveness and sustainability of Indian industry. 

While India is facing a very challenging situation due to the Coronavirus crisis, Indian industry’s actions will be key to revival as it explores newer opportunities. There is renewed need to converge industry efforts in the spirit of partnership that BCIC has built over the years. 

Against this background, Bangalore Chamber of Industry and Commerce (BCIC) will be holding its 43rd Annual General Meeting at 6.00 pm on August 7, 2020 through Video Conference. The Theme for the current year AGM is:- Namma Karnataka - The Gateway to Future India, with a focus on positioning Karnataka as a preferred investment destination.

We are pleased to inform you that this year Shri Jagadish Shettar, Hon’ble Minister for Large and Medium Scale Industry, Government of Karnataka is the Chief Guest and will deliver the Guest Address; Shri. Vikram Kirloskar, CMD, Kirloskar Systems Ltd, Vice Chairman, Toyota Kirloskar Motor Ltd and Immediate Past President, Confederation of Indian Industry (CII) is the Guest of Honour and will deliver the Keynote Address at the AGM.

Agenda

    • Coinciding with the AGM, the Chamber will be releasing Exclusive Reports on the following publications:  

      BCIC – Deloitte Survey Report on how Karnataka can emerge as the most preferred investment destination given the impact of COVID-19 on global economy 
      BCIC Exclusive Report - The Gateway to Karnataka – A New Second Airport for the Bengaluru Region  
      BCIC - Aatmanirbhar Bharat Analysis Report 
        
      The Annual Session, as always, will see participation of Thought leaders, policy-makers, strategists, industry leaders and media.
